Crustless Asparagus Quiche

  • Yield: 6 servings

Asparagus is sautéed until tender and flavored with young green garlic, which is milder and sweeter than it after reaching maturity.

Ingredients

-- Oil or cooking spray, for the baking dish and skillet
2cups asparagus, chopped bite size
2stalks green garlic, chopped (or 2 garlic cloves and 2 scallions, chopped and mixed)
-- Salt and pepper
4large eggs
1cup nonfat milk
1cup low-fat ricotta cheese

Instructions

  1. Preheat the oven to 375F. Prepare an 8-inch square baking dish with a light coating of oil or cooking spray. Prepare a skillet with another light coating of oil or cooking spray.
  2. Place the prepared skillet over medium-high heat. Sauté the asparagus, stirring once or twice, for 5 to 7 minutes, or until the asparagus has just started to brown.
  3. Add the green garlic or garlic and scallion to the skillet and cook 2 to 3 minutes more, or until asparagus is partially browned. Remove from heat and season with salt and pepper to taste.
  4. Whisk together the eggs and milk in a mixing bowl. Fold in the ricotta and stir to combine. Fold in the sautéed veggies and pour into the prepared baking dish.
  5. Cook for 25 to 30 minutes, or until the eggs are set and puffy. Let cool slightly before serving.

Nutritional Info *per serving

  • Calories 117
  • Fat 6g
  • Saturated Fat 2g
  • Cholesterol 154mg
  • Sodium 172mg
  • Potassium 254mg
  • Carbohydrate 7g
  • Fiber 1g
  • Sugars 4g
  • Protein 12g
